> This document entitled: FPGA Programming for the Masses
> The programmability of FPGAs must improve if they are to be part of 
> mainstream
> computing. Written by David F. Bacon, Rodric Rabbah, Sunil Shukla, T.J. 
> Watson
> Research Center, goes to the center of that conversation.
> 
> The authors discuss in depth the issue of programmability of the FPGA, an
> essential device, present in all "leading edge" State of the Art SDR Radios
> currently available or under development.
